Factors to Consider When Choosing Microphone For Streaming

Choosing the right microphone for streaming involves understanding several key factors that influence both sound quality and usability. It’s important to match your microphone with your setup, budget, and streaming goals. Whether you prioritize simplicity or advanced control, knowing what to look for can help you avoid common pitfalls and make a smarter investment.

Connectivity and Compatibility

Consider whether you want a USB microphone for plug-and-play simplicity or an XLR model for professional-grade sound. Many streamers start with USB for ease, but XLR microphones offer more flexibility and higher quality if you’re willing to invest in additional equipment like an audio interface. Compatibility with your computer or streaming setup is essential, so check device requirements before buying.

Sound Quality and Pickup Pattern

Sound clarity is paramount; look for microphones with cardioid patterns that focus on your voice while rejecting background noise. Some models offer multiple pickup patterns, providing versatility for different environments or multi-person streams. Beware of low-quality mics that produce tinny or muffled audio, which can diminish viewer engagement.

Built-in Features and Controls

Features like mute buttons, gain controls, and headphone monitoring can greatly improve your streaming experience. Some microphones include DSP effects or noise suppression, reducing post-production work. However, more features often mean a steeper learning curve and higher cost, so prioritize what will genuinely improve your stream.

Ease of Use and Setup

Simplicity is key for many streamers, especially beginners. USB microphones typically require minimal setup, while XLR models demand additional gear and technical knowledge. Consider your comfort level with hardware setup and whether a model with onboard controls or software integration suits your workflow better.

Build Quality and Durability

A sturdy build can withstand long-term use and frequent handling. Cheaper models may feel flimsy or develop issues over time, impacting your streaming reliability. Investing in a well-constructed microphone can prevent disruptions and ensure consistent performance during long streaming sessions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is a condenser or dynamic microphone better for streaming?

Condenser microphones are generally preferred for streaming because they capture more detail and have a wider frequency response, making voices sound clearer and richer. However, they are more sensitive to background noise, so they work best in controlled environments. Dynamic microphones tend to reject ambient sound better and are more durable, making them suitable if your streaming space is noisy or if you prefer a more robust build.

Do I need an XLR microphone for streaming?

An XLR microphone can offer superior audio quality and greater customization, but it requires additional equipment like an audio interface and proper setup skills. For most beginner and intermediate streamers, a good USB microphone provides ample quality with a much simpler setup. XLR models make more sense for those planning serious audio production or upgrading their setup over time.

What features should I prioritize if I stream from multiple platforms?

If you stream across various platforms or need flexibility, look for microphones with multiple connectivity options, such as hybrid USB/XLR models. Onboard controls like gain and mute buttons help manage live audio quickly, while wide compatibility ensures your microphone works seamlessly with different software and hardware. Also, consider models with software support for advanced audio adjustments.

Is background noise cancellation necessary for streaming?

Background noise cancellation can significantly improve audio quality, especially in less controlled environments. Many microphones now include noise suppression features or work well with external software for filtering ambient sounds. However, investing in a quiet environment and proper microphone placement can often reduce the need for complex noise cancellation features, simplifying your setup.

How important is build quality for a streaming microphone?

Build quality affects both durability and sound stability. A well-made microphone resists damage from frequent handling and can provide consistent performance over time. Cheaper models may develop issues like static or loose connections, which can disrupt your stream. Spending a bit more on a sturdy microphone can save you troubleshooting time and ensure reliable operation during long sessions.
